Maluma
has become one of the most important Latin artists in the music scene, but not only that, the Colombian has an unparalleled gallantry that has positioned him as one of the most coveted singles.
That is why his latest publication on Instagram caused a stir among his 55 million followers, as he appears carrying a baby, a fact that unleashed countless comments on the network.
It is about
Máximo
, son of
Pipe Bueno
and
Luisa Fernanda W
, who was born on October 28 and is the godson of the interpreter of 'Hawaii'.
"This little angel is my godson Máximo. By the way, how do you see me as Dad? Congratulations
@pipebueno
and
@luisafernandaw
, I love you very much!", Wrote Maluma on Instagram along with a beautiful postcard in which he looks very happy while holding the newborn.
Before the question, thousands of fans expressed their answers.
Some assured that he would be a great father, while the most daring went out of their way to flatter him.
"I sign up to be the mother", "I always imagine you as the father of my children", "You would look beautiful, but only if the son is with me", "You are already a daddy without the need for children", it reads in the comments.
For her part, Luisa Fernanda W reaffirmed what her loyal fans assured, "¡Te luce, Juan Luis!", Referring to the fact that the artist looks very good next to the little one.

Throughout the years, Maluma and Pipe Bueno have formed a beautiful musical family and share many important moments in their lives.
Their relationship is so close that on several occasions they have expressed their admiration for each other.
In July 2019, Pipe shared with 'People' magazine that Maluma is an artist worthy of recognition not only for his talent, but for his philanthropic work.
"He is a character who is giant, who is a world star, who is part of the musical elite today," he said about his friend and colleague, "but who takes time to support youth with the foundation 'El arte of dreams' for the boys who get lost in the streets, who get lost in drugs and on bad roads. And what better way than to reroute them through art and music? ".
